Hyundai Motor India’s Rs 25,000 crore initial public offering (IPO) has been approved by SEBI

SEBI has approved Hyundai Motor India’s IPO, bringing the company’s intentions to list one step closer. Hyundai India hopes to raise Rs 25,000 crore, or $3 billion, through the offer, regarded as India’s largest public issue. This indicates a $20 billion valuation for Hyundai. Trent, BEL may receive $900 million in inflow from a possible Nifty inclusion.

If Trent and Bharat Electronics (BEL) are included in the September review’s Nifty 50 index, they might draw inflows of approximately $900 million. The modifications will become effective on September 30 and will be made public on August 23. These two stocks will replace Divi’s Laboratories and LTIMindtree.
